Highlights
Are people in Lynchburg older or younger than people in Hillsboro?
- The Median Age in Lynchburg is 22.2 years younger than in Hillsboro.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lynchburg or Hillsboro?
- Lynchburg housing costs are 80.5% more expensive than Hillsboro hous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lynchburg or Hillsboro?
- The average commute for residents of Lynchburg is 9.9 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Hillsboro.

Things to do in Hillsboro?
Living in Hillsboro, WV is an enjoyable experience for many people. The small town atmosphere offers a sense of community among its citizens, as well as plenty of scenic views and local attractions. There is a convenient selection of shops and restaurants in the area, making it easy to find something to eat or shop for. Additionally, the nearby mountains provide plenty of opportunities to en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and fishing. People who live in Hillsboro also appreciate the low cost of living, which makes it especially attractive for families looking to move here. All in all, Hillsboro is a great place to call home with its friendly people and beautiful natural surroundings.
